Nepal Cultural Heritage Swatambuenat Monastery Buddha Statues
The sculpture is a standing statue of the Buddha, carved from a single huge granite stone. It is located in the Swatambuenat (Swayambhunath) temple in Kathmandu, Nepal. Built in the 10th century, this is one of the oldest sculptures in Swayambu. The sculpture is located on the front of the hill, along the ancient road leading to the stupa.
Stone Statues of Buddha Sitting on All Sides of the Northern Wei Dynasty
In 1957, the stone statues of Buddha sitting in the four niches of the Northern Wei Dynasty unearthed in Nanniwan, Qin County, were collected by the Nanniwan Stone Carving Museum in Qin County. There are 4 niches and 4 statues of Buddha.
Bust of Miroslav Thiels
He was a famous Czech philosopher, art historian, and the founder of the Slok movement. Born into a German family, but later identified firmly with Czech identity and changed his name from Friedrich Emanuel Tiles to the Czechoslovakized Miroslav Tiles. Deeply influenced by the Czech Enlightenment and the Revolution of 1848, Thiels worked for the Czech National Revival. He advocated the concept of "a sound mind resides in a sound body", and emphasized the cultivation of character, discipline and cooperative spirit through gymnastics exercises to achieve self-governance.
Statues of St. John in Nepomuk
A very well-known figure in Czech history, he served as Deputy Bishop of Prague during the reign of Vaclav IV. He was the first in the Catholic Church to become a martyr for sticking to the secrecy of his confession. Under Catholic Church rules, priests have a sacred duty of secrecy over the contents of the confession, and St. John was killed for refusing to reveal the contents of the queen's confession to the king. He was thrown into the river from the Charles Bridge. Legend has it that five stars appeared on his head when he was dying. From then on, the stars and the number five were regarded as symbols of Saint John. St. John is revered for his adherence to faith and moral principles, and is a saint against defamation and against the flood.

Veles Statues
Is an important god in Slavic mythology, mainly in charge of the earth, water and the underworld. It is regarded as the protector of domestic animals, especially cattle, and the ruler of the dead. In Slavic cultures, he was closely associated with death and the cycle of nature and was considered a powerful god, in charge of the end of life and the destination of the soul. The image is changeable, sometimes depicted as a god with horns and long beard, sometimes as a giant snake or half-man and half-snake, symbolizing his strength and wisdom. Known for his cunning and wisdom, he is often opposed to Perron, the god of thunder and lightning, and the confrontation between the two symbolizes storms and lightning in nature.

Moai on Easter Island
Moai (Moai), is located in Easter Island (Easter Island) a group of giant people, all over the island, is Chile's tourist scenery and one of the world heritage. More than 1000 huge stone bust-faced statues were found throughout the island, 600 of which are neatly arranged on the seaside stone island. The stone statues vary in size, 6-23 meters high, and weigh about 30-90 tons. They have a peculiar image, a serious expression, and their backs to the sea seem to be thoughtful.
